- #ifndef __INTERRUPT_H__
- #define __INTERRUPT_H__
- //*****************************************************************************
- //
- // If building with a C++ compiler, make all of the definitions in this header
- // have a C binding.
- //
- //*****************************************************************************
- #ifdef __cplusplus
- extern "C"
- {
- #endif
- //*****************************************************************************
- //
- // Macro to generate an interrupt priority mask based on the number of bits
- // of priority supported by the hardware.
- //
- //*****************************************************************************
- #define INT_PRIORITY_MASK ((0xFF << (8 - NUM_PRIORITY_BITS)) & 0xFF)
- //*****************************************************************************
- //
- // Prototypes for the APIs.
- //
- //*****************************************************************************
- extern tBoolean IntMasterEnable(void);
- extern tBoolean IntMasterDisable(void);
- extern void IntRegister(unsigned long ulInterrupt, void (*pfnHandler)(void));
- extern void IntUnregister(unsigned long ulInterrupt);
- extern void IntPriorityGroupingSet(unsigned long ulBits);
- extern unsigned long IntPriorityGroupingGet(void);
- extern void IntPrioritySet(unsigned long ulInterrupt,
- unsigned char ucPriority);
- extern long IntPriorityGet(unsigned long ulInterrupt);
- extern void IntEnable(unsigned long ulInterrupt);
- extern void IntDisable(unsigned long ulInterrupt);
- extern void IntPendSet(unsigned long ulInterrupt);
- extern void IntPendClear(unsigned long ulInterrupt);
- extern void IntPriorityMaskSet(unsigned long ulPriorityMask);
- extern unsigned long IntPriorityMaskGet(void);
- //*****************************************************************************
- //
- // Mark the end of the C bindings section for C++ compilers.
- //
- //*****************************************************************************
- #ifdef __cplusplus
- }
- #endif
- #endif // __INTERRUPT_H__
